Transaction 8ec371b6a525e42a5e41333fdde156d9e9759b70a9a01cf37886de28e35e6002
1 Input
1 Output
-
8ec371b6a525e42a5e41333fdde156d9e9759b70a9a01cf37886de28e35e6002:0
- value
- 16064
- script pubkey
- OP_0 OP_PUSHBYTES_20 08342d59b249f1c116eeecddc4545b5fdc442675
- address
- bc1qpq6z6kdjf8cuz9hwanwug4zmtlwygfn4updzl3